International Student Edition Textbooks: What's The Difference?

what is an international student edition textbook

International student edition textbooks are published by the international counterparts of educational publishers. They are usually cheaper than their US-published counterparts, saving students hundreds of dollars every semester. International editions are often printed in black and white and may have thinner pages, but the content is the same as the US version. They can be more difficult to find in US bookstores, as selling international editions could infringe on the sale and distribution rights of the international publisher and jeopardize their relationship with US-based publication offices. However, they can be found on online bookstores such as Amazon, eBay, and BookScouter, as well as on buyback platforms such as BookDeal.com and BookScouter.com.

They can be resold, but have received criticism and court cases

International edition textbooks are often cheaper than their US-published counterparts, making them attractive options for students looking to save money. However, the resale of these textbooks has been a controversial topic, with critics arguing that it undermines the business partnerships between bookstores and US-based publishers. This controversy has even led to court cases, such as the one involving Supap Kirtsaeng, a Thai student who sold textbooks bought abroad to help fund his education. Kirtsaeng was sued by the publisher John Wiley & Sons for copyright infringement, sparking a debate around the first-sale doctrine and the resale of products made outside the United States.

The case brought attention to the practice of buying and reselling international edition textbooks, which had received criticism for potentially infringing on the sale and distribution rights of international publishers. Despite the controversy, the Supreme Court ruled in favor of Kirtsaeng, stating that the first sale doctrine applied to his case. This ruling gave textbook resellers the confidence to continue their business, knowing that their activities were legal under US copyright law.

While the resale of international edition textbooks can be profitable, it is important to be aware of potential challenges. Some students may be skeptical about purchasing these editions, especially if the price is not right. Additionally, not all vendors accept international edition textbooks, so it is crucial to check with the vendor before attempting to resell.

To identify an international edition textbook, individuals can look for stickers or labels on the book indicating that it is a "low price edition" or "international edition (IE)." Online bookselling platforms also often note if a book is an international edition in their descriptions. Before purchasing an international edition textbook, students should ensure that it matches their course requirements by checking the ISBN and comparing it to the required textbook's ISBN.
